Differences Between Cascade, Bubble, and Sink Airlocks


1. Pressure Differential:

  • Cascade Airlock: Maintains a positive pressure differential between each airlock in the series.
  • Bubble Airlock: Maintains a positive pressure differential within the enclosed volume.
  • Sink Airlock: Maintains a negative pressure differential within the airlock.


2. Airflow:

  • Cascade Airlock: Air flows from the clean area to the non-clean area through each airlock in sequence.
  • Bubble Airlock: Air flows into the bubble through a HEPA filter, creating a positive pressure differential.
  • Sink Airlock: Air flows into the sink through a HEPA filter, creating a negative pressure differential.


3. Applications:

  • Cascade Airlock: Suitable for high-risk applications in pharmaceutical manufacturing.
  • Bubble Airlock: Suitable for applications requiring a high degree of cleanliness, such as semiconductor manufacturing.
  • Sink Airlock: Suitable for applications requiring a high degree of cleanliness, such as pharmaceutical manufacturing.
